Today in 1835
 Children, employed in the silk mills in Paterson, N.J., go on strike for an 11-hour day and six-day week. A compromise settlement resulted in a 69-hour work week. ~ Labor Tribune

US Food Talks Continue as Contract Expiration Looms
Posted On: Apr 19, 2012


Mar. 9, 2012 | Committee members (L-R) Business Agent Dan Taylor, Joseph Schwabline, Sr., Business Agent Jim Deene, Lou Lough, and Ed Mulford met to discuss proposals and strategy before a March 7th bargaining session with USFoods. Bargaining began in early February. The contract expires March 15.
